Reintegration Road
Navigating difficulties of reintegration can be a daunting process. It requires significant self-reflection. Individuals must navigate various hurdles such as securing a job and restoring connections. Helpful resources play a essential function in facilitating a positive reintegration journey.
- Developing self-worth
- Accessing mental health services
- Finding a sense of belonging
The Weight of Eternity
For some individuals, the judicial system offers a sentence with no end in sight. A life sentence, a term that evokes both fear and compassion, represents an irrevocable pact. It means being permanently separated from the outside world, confined within the harsh walls of a prison. The days merge together in an endless routine of time passing with little to no hope of freedom.
- Many factors contribute to the imposition of such a sentence, ranging from heinous crimes to acts committed in a state of mental disturbance.
- The impact on both the sentenced individual and their loved ones is profound and lasting.
